Key Responsibilities: Provide specialized nephrology care in hospital settings, including ICU, CCU, ED, and Med-Surg units. Oversee and manage patient care, collaborating with a small interdisciplinary team of clinicians. Deliver dialysis treatments, including Hemodialysis, Peritoneal Dialysis, Continuous Renal Replacement Therapy (CRRT), and Apheresis. Conduct patient assessments, monitor vital signs, and ensure proper setup and operation of dialysis machines. Work in a dynamic environment with the flexibility to adapt to patient needs and changing schedules. Participate in on-call rotations as required by the hospital system.
